Analysis
The most recent figure for services, value added (constant 2015 us$), per square kilometre in Qatar is 7.52 million const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re, measured in 2023. That is the highest value across all 44 years on record.
That represents a change of up 2.1% on the previous year and up 39.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, services, value added (constant 2015 us$), per square kilometre in Qatar peaked at 7.52 million const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re in 2023 and was at its lowest, 436,871 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re, in 1980.
That places Qatar 22nd out of 193 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the top qu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
Services, value added (constant 2015 US$)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Services, value added (constant 2015 US$) ÷ Land area (sq. km)
Computed from
- Services, value added Country official statistics, National Statistical Offices (NSOs)
- Land area FAOSTAT,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ations (FAO)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
